Outdoor exercise offers more than just a change of scenery—it’s backed by research as a way to boost both physical and mental health.
Studies show that outdoor workouts can improve mood, reduce stress and anxiety, and even enhance self-esteem. Exposure to sunlight naturally increases your body’s vitamin D levels, which supports bone health and immune function. Plus, green spaces and fresh air stimulate the parasympathetic nervous system, helping your body relax and recover more efficiently.

Outdoor workouts can also provide an extra challenge. Uneven terrain and natural elements like wind or hills engage different muscle groups and improve balance and coordination. Research even suggests that people are more likely to stick with their fitness routine when they incorporate outdoor activities because it feels less like a chore and more like recreation.
